As "just-for-fun" as this post may be, there are a few things to glean from the parody and the original vid.

1.  This video was posted on YouTube in January.  It had only 10,000 views . . . until Jimmy Kimmel tweeted the bejesus out of it.  Now it's got 4.5 million.  To spread your word, look for people with big mouths and a lot of people already listening.

2.  The authors of the parody found something they enjoyed (and something that audiences already enjoyed), adapted it using their unique voice, and created something they've monetized.  Isn't that the same story behind Mamma Mia?  Wicked?  The Phantom of the Opera?

3.  The best viral videos aren't made, they just sort of happen naturally . . . like, well, like a rainbow.
